Concept
Learner-centred teaching shifts the active work of learning from one-way delivery to student participation. Interaction is strongest when learners exchange ideas, respond to peers, and build understanding together.
Application
Among the given methods, group discussion directly organises learning around students speaking, listening, questioning, and responding to one another. The teacher facilitates the exchange rather than delivering most of the content.
Contrast
A seminar generally centres on a prepared presentation followed by limited questions and discussion.
A workshop is participatory and hands-on, but its activity is commonly organised around practising a skill under facilitator guidance.
A lecture mainly uses structured speaker-to-audience delivery, so learner-to-learner exchange is not its defining feature.
Cross-check
Applying the defining test—whether learners continuously exchange and develop ideas with peers—selects group discussion.
Result
Therefore, the most interactive and student-centred method among the offered choices is Group Discussion.
